Unified Payments Interface was launched with much fanfare last week, and a lot of banks have started going live with their own UPI apps. However, both the banks as well as the National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) have been flooded with queries from customers who have faced issues while accessing the new mode of payment in town. ET tried to decode some of the questions that were posted on social media.

 Are all banks on UPI?

 Till now 21 banks have gone live on Upi App Bank, but few major ones such as State Bank of India, HDFC Bank, IndusInd Bank are not yet on UPI. These banks are expected to join by November. The banks that have their UPI apps include Andhra Bank, Axis Bank, Bank of Maharashtra, Bhartiya Mahila Bank, Canara Bank, Catholic Syrian Bank, DCB Bank, Federal Bank, ICICI Bank, TJSB Sahakari Bank, Oriental Bank of Commerce, Karnataka Bank, UCO Bank, Union Bank of India, United Bank of India, Punjab National Bank, South Indian Bank, Vijaya Bank and YES Bank.

 What happens if my bank's name is not on the list?

 If you are banking with RBL Bank or IDBI Bank, you will still get the benefit of UPI by using some other bank's UPI app. But if you are with any other bank, you will have to wait till November to be able to use UPI.

 Why is my phone's app store not showing any UPI apps?

 If you are using an Apple phone or a Windows phone, then it will not show. UPI, as of now, is available only for Android smartphone users. Feature phone users will also not get the benefits of UPI.

 Why is my account not getting connected to Upi App Bank?

 Many people who tried integrating their bank accounts with UPI have found difficulty in doing so. However, in many such cases, it has been found that the account has become dormant. A dormant account is one where no withdrawal or issuing of cheque has happened in six months. In such cases, individuals will first need to activate the account and then start operating.

 Why is my mobile number not getting registered on Upi App Bank?

 To be able to use UPI, customers first need to register their mobile number with the bank. If their mobile number is not registered, or they are trying to use UPI on some other number, UPI will not function. While activating the mobile app, the customer needs to get his mobile number verified by the system. If he is using some other mobile number, UPI will not get registered.
